Venue: Swansea.com Stadium Date: Saturday, 28 January Kick-off:17.15 GMT
Coverage: Live commentary on Radio Wales, Radio Cymru and BBC Sport online, report on BBC Sport website & app.

Stephen Myler is back from injury, as Ospreys face off against United Rugby Championship leader Edinburgh.

Gareth Anscombe has been released from Wales’ Six Nations camp and provides cover for the fly-half, who has not appeared in nearly two months.

Edinburgh welcomes back internationals to help them win in Swansea, their first victory since 2009.

All members of the starting XV include Jaco van den Walt, Henry Pyrgos and Dave Cherry, Marshall Sykes, Magnus Bradbury, and Marshall Sykes.

Ospreys are currently in sixth place in the league and have made some changes to the side that was already depleted. beaten by Sale to end their Champions Cup campaign.

Matt Protheroe shifts to fullback to make room for Keelan Gilles on the wing. Myler returns to his halfback partnership with Rhys Webb.

Sam Parry, who has not played since December 12, is back at hooker. Rhys Davies is also back, and Will Griffiths is in the pack to replace Adam Beard (on Wales duty) and Sam Cross.

Harry Deaves retains his open-side spot after impressing on his debut last week.

High-flying Edinburgh travels to South Wales to try and win their seventh victory of the season.

They made nine modifications to the side. hammered Brive in the Challenge Cup.

In addition to the internationals returning, Matt Currie, a young centre, and Henry Immelman, a full-back, both start. Boan Venter, an open-side flanker, and Connor Boyle, Connor Boyle, return to the pack.

Darcy Graham will be the first to join the wing after being released from Scotland’s Six Nations camp. Jamie Hodgson and Ben Vellacott are the replacements.

Toby Booth, Ospreys’ head coach: “We are looking forward to challenging our self, as we always do against top-notch people.

“The most exciting thing about this for us is that it’s at home and we have people coming in to see.

“Everyone enjoys watching live sports and performing in front live audiences. In those tough moments, your home crowd can make a huge difference.”

Edinburgh head coach Mike Blair: “It’s fantastic to go into this game after a very encouraging win against Brive. There were a lot positive things done in attack and defense, however, as a team we know that Ospreys will prove much more difficult, especially away from home.

“The Ospreys squad is made up of both internationalists with experience and young talent. They’ll be searching for a response after a few tough losses in Europe.”
